Researchers at Graz University of Technology (TU Graz) in Austria have developed a clever new way to put buildings together—using a system similar to Velcro. The innovation comes from the ReCon project, which teamed up TU Graz experts with industry partners to explore how hook-and-loop fasteners could transform construction.
